Servers are excepted from this change.īefore the Windows latest update, there was a way to disable Microsoft Defender via the registry. This applies both to managed clients (E3 and E5) and to unmanaged devices (home and pro-SKU). Setting this value to true will not change Microsoft Defender Antivirus behaviour on client devices. However, it was always hard to turn off Microsoft Defender in Windows 10, and when you pause its real-time protection, it automatically turns back on. ![]() It protects PCs against viruses, malware and other threats. Microsoft Defender is in-built antivirus software in Windows 10. For disabling the DisableAntiSpyware, Microsoft said, However, Microsoft has not given any reason for making these changes with the update. If you know, then DisableAntiSpyware was used to disable Microsoft Defender. One of the change is Microsoft has disabled the Registry Key DisableAntiSpyware. Earlier, this month, Microsoft has released an update for security program which brought two major changes.
